Method for Controlling a Multitude of Braking Devices and Braking System of a Vehicle
20240408968 ยท 2024-12-12
Inventors
- Huba NEMETH (Budapest, HU)
- Zoltan Toth (Budapest, HU)
- Tamas DOHANY (Pecs, HU)
- Aron KUTAS (Izsak, HU)
- Gabor LIPTAK (Budapest, HU)
- Krisztian SANDOR (Budapest, HU)
Cpc classification
B60T1/10
PERFORMING OPERATIONS; TRANSPORTING
B60T2270/613
PERFORMING OPERATIONS; TRANSPORTING
B60T2270/604
PERFORMING OPERATIONS; TRANSPORTING
International classification
Abstract
A method for controlling a multitude of braking devices of a vehicle to effect a desired brake function quantified as a desired brake parameter, wherein each of the braking devices is controllable by an actuation parameter to effect at least a portion of said desired brake function, comprising the steps: determine, for each braking device, a brake capability representing a maximum brake function achievable by the braking device; determine, for each braking device, an actuation priority, wherein the actuation priority is determined from at least one predetermined operating parameter of the braking device and/or the vehicle; in order from highest priority to lowest priority of the braking means, allocating, to each braking device, the actuation parameter, wherein the actuation parameter is chosen between the brake capability and the quantity of the desired brake parameter not yet allocated to other braking devices, whichever is lower. Further, a braking system for a vehicle is configured to carry out the method.
Claims
1.-9. (canceled)
10. A method for controlling a multitude of braking devices of a vehicle to effect a desired brake function quantified as a desired brake parameter, wherein each of the braking devices is controllable by an actuation parameter to effect at least a portion of said desired brake function, the method comprising the steps of: determining, for each braking device, a brake capability representing a maximum brake function achievable by the braking device, determining, for each braking device, an actuation priority, wherein the actuation priority is determined from at least one predetermined operating parameter of the braking device and/or the vehicle; and in order from highest priority to lowest priority of the braking devices, allocating, to each braking device, the actuation parameter, wherein the actuation parameter is chosen between the brake capability and the quantity of the desired brake parameter not yet allocated to other braking devices, whichever is lower.
11. The method according to claim 10, wherein the desired brake parameter, the maximum actuation parameter and/or the actuation parameter each are expressed as one of the following: a torque, a force, a retardation.
12. The method according to claim 10, wherein when determining the actuation priority, braking devices comprising non-frictional brakes are determined to have a higher priority than braking devices comprising frictional brakes.
13. The method according to claim 10, wherein when determining the actuation priority, braking devices comprising regenerational brakes are determined to have a higher priority than braking devices comprising dissipational brakes.
14. The method according to claim 13, wherein when determining the actuation priority, the higher a regeneration efficiency of a regenerational brake, the higher its priority relative to other brakes comprising regenerational brakes.
15. The method according to claim 10, wherein when determining the actuation priority, one or more of the following parameters is taken into account: type or types of brake(s) comprised in the braking devices, efficiency of regenerational brakes comprised in the braking devices, recuperation ratio of regenerational brake devices comprised in the braking devices, current vehicle speed, current dynamic vehicle state, state of charge of a traction battery, axle load of the vehicle, individual loads on each axle of the vehicle, brake device response time, brake device response brake force, configurable priority value.
16. The method according to claim 10, wherein where a braking device comprises multiple brake devices, the actuation parameter is distributed among the multiple brake devices according to predefined and/or calculated distribution ratios.
17. The method according to claim 10, wherein when multiple braking devices are determined to have the same actuation priority, in the allocating step, the brake capabilities of the multiple braking devices determined to have the same actuation priority are conflated and the actuation parameter allocated to the multiple braking devices is distributed among the brake devices according to predefined and/or calculated allocation ratios.
18. A braking system of a vehicle, comprising: a first braking device comprising at least one frictional brake, a second braking device comprising at least one regenerative brake, and a control device, wherein the control device is configured to: determine, for each braking device, a brake capability representing a maximum brake function achievable by the braking device, determine, for each braking device, an actuation priority, wherein the actuation priority is determined from at least one predetermined operating parameter of the braking device and/or the vehicle; in order from highest priority to lowest priority of the braking devices, allocate, to each braking device, the actuation parameter, wherein the actuation parameter is chosen between the brake capability and the quantity of the desired brake parameter not yet allocated to other braking devices, whichever is lower.
Description
BRIEF DESCRIPTION OF THE DRAWING
[0029]
DETAILED DESCRIPTION OF THE DRAWING
[0030] The braking system 10 of an electric vehicle comprises a first braking device 12, a second braking device 14 and a third braking device 16. The braking system 10 further comprises a control device 18 configured to control the braking devices 12, 14, 16.
[0031] The first braking device 12 comprises a frictional brake. The second braking devices 14 comprises a non-frictional dissipational brake. The third braking device 16 comprises a non-frictional regenerational brake.
[0032] In further embodiments, each of the braking devices 12, 14, 16 may comprise one or more brake devices.
[0033] Each of the braking devices 12, 14, 16 is controllable by means of an actuation parameter which may, for example, be transmitted mechanically (e.g. displacement, brake pedal), electrically (e.g. as a voltage) or electronically (e.g. digitally via a communication bus or by direct connection). The control device 18 is configured to provide the actuation parameter to the braking devices 12, 14, 16 such that the braking devices 12, 14, 16 together effect the desired brake function.
[0034] When the vehicle needs to brake, the control device 18 carries out a method for controlling the multitude of braking devices 12, 14, 16 to effect the desired brake function. The desired brake function is usually communicated to the control device 18 as a representation of a desired braking parameter to be controlled. Examples for such desired braking parameters may be e.g. a desired braking force, a desired braking torque or a desired braking retardation/acceleration.
[0035] Each of the braking devices 12, 14, 16 has a brake capability. Such a brake capability represents a maximum brake function achievable with a braking device. This maximum brake function may, for example, be represented as a maximum brake torque. The maximum brake torque of each braking device may be dependent on a dynamic state of the vehicle, in particular on its speed. The control device 18 determines, in a first step, for each braking device 12, 14, 16 the brake capability representing a maximum brake function achievable with said braking device 12, 14, 16.
[0036] In further embodiments, the brake capability may, for example, be also determined by a measured dynamic state of the vehicle, for example a wheel slip, an allowed slip or slip stiffness and/or a state of charge of a traction battery of the vehicle. This may help to avoid ABS activity and/or overcharging the traction battery.
[0037] In a second step, the control device 18 determines, for each braking device 12, 14, 16, an actuation priority, wherein the actuation priority is determined from at least one predetermined operating parameter of the braking devices 12, 14, 16 and/or the vehicle.
[0038] In further embodiments, the predetermined operating parameter may, for example, be the kind of brake comprised in the braking devices. For example, for an electric vehicle, it may be expedient to achieve as much of the desired brake parameter as possible using regenerational brakes as comprised in the braking devices 16. Furthermore, it may be expedient to achieve as much of the desired brake parameter as possible using non-frictional brakes as comprised in the braking devices 14, 16.
[0039] These considerations would, in that particular case, lead to the braking device 16 having the highest priority, the braking device 14 having the second highest priority and the braking device 12 having the third highest priority.
[0040] The control device 18 will then, in a third step, go through the braking devices 12, 14, 16 in order from highest priority to lowest priority and allocate an actuation parameter to each of the braking devices 12, 14, 16. Each of the actuation parameters represents a portion of the desired brake function to be effected by each of the braking devices 12, 14, 16. The actuation parameter for each braking device 12, 14, 16 is chosen between the brake capability, as this represents the maximum brake function that can be affected by each of the braking devices 12, 14, 16 and the quantity of the desired brake parameter not allocated to other braking devices, whichever is lower.
[0041] To further illustrate this method, the following example calculations resulting from the method will be shown. Each of these examples is not based on actual measurements but constructed only to better show how to carry out the method. The values given herein are also not measured but given for illustration purposes only.
[0042] The first braking device 12, which comprises a frictional brake, may, for example, have a maximum brake torque between 15000 Nm and 17000 Nm depending on the speed that the vehicle is moving at.
[0043] The second braking device 14 may, for example, have a maximum brake torque of 4000 Nm. The third braking device 16 may, for example, have a maximum brake torque of 2500 Nm.
[0044] In a first example, the driver of the vehicle may press the brake pedal such that the desired brake torque is 3000 Nm.
[0045] The control device 18 has determined the highest priority braking device to be the regenerational third brake 16, the second highest priority braking devices to be the dissipational second brake 14 and the third highest priority braking devices to be the frictional third brake 12. The control device 18 may, for example, keep information about the priorities of the braking devices 12, 14, 16 in a memory as an ordered list.
[0046] The control device 18 starts by allocating an actuation parameter to the (regenerational) third brake 16 because the third brake 16 has the highest priority. The maximum brake torque of the third brake 16 is 2500 Nm, which is smaller than the desired brake torque of 3000 Nm. The control device 18 allocates the maximum value of 2500 Nm to the third brake 16.
[0047] The control device 18 then allocates the remaining desired brake torque of 500 Nm as the actuation parameter to the second brake 14, which is the brake 12, 14, 16 having the next lower priority, wherein the allocated desired brake torque of 500 Nm is lower than the maximum brake torque of the second brake.
[0048] The braking device 12, 14, 16 having the next lower priority is the frictional first brake 12 which, in this example, is allocated an actuation parameter representing 0 as all of the desired brake torque has already been allocated to higher priority braking devices 14, 16. Thus, in this case, no further brake function beyond that which has already been allocated is necessary to achieve the desired brake function.
[0049] The braking devices 12, 14, 16 will then, according to the actuation parameters transmitted to them, effect a braking torque.
[0050] In another example, when the desired braking torque is 2500 Nm or less, only the regenerational third brake 16 will be allocated and receive an actuation parameter representing more braking torque than 0.
[0051] In yet another example, when the desired braking torque exceeds the combined maximum braking torque of the second and third brake 14, 16, the remaining braking torque will be allocated to the first frictional brake 12.
[0052] In further embodiments, multiple regenerational first braking devices 16 may be present. These first braking devices 16 may have different efficiencies. When determining the actuation priority of the braking devices 12, 14, 16, the control device 18 will determine first braking devices 16 having a higher efficiency to have a higher priority relative to other first braking devices 16 having a lower efficiency.
[0053] In further embodiments, when multiple braking devices 12, 14, 16 are present, they may be located on different axles of the vehicle. If, in this situation, any of the braking devices 12, 14, 16 have the same priority, the control device 18 will, for example, allocate the actuation parameter according to the load present on each of the axles. In particular, the control device 18 will, for example, allocate more of the actuation parameter to braking devices 12, 14, 16 located on the axle having a higher load.
[0054] In further embodiments, when, more generally, multiple braking devices 12, 14, 16 are arranged on different sides of the vehicle, for example some braking devices 12, 14, 16 are arranged on the left side of the vehicle while other braking devices 12, 14, 16 are arranged on the right side of the vehicle, the control device 18 will, for example, allocate the actuation parameter such that the braking parameter on each side of the vehicle is balanced. In this way, a situation wherein the vehicle is steered into a particular direction by unbalanced braking is avoided. In these embodiments, the actuation parameter may, for example, be distributed among the brake devices and/or the braking devices 12, 14, 16 according to predefined or calculated distribution ratios and/or allocation ratios. For example, when a vehicle is currently driving in a curve, a distribution or allocation ratio may be calculated to distribute or allocate 60% of the braking torque (braking parameter) on one side and 40% of the braking torque (braking parameter) on the other side of the vehicle.
[0055] In further embodiments, for example, braking devices 12, 14, 16 of the same kind located on the same axle but on different sides of the vehicle are determined to have the same priority. In this case, the actuation parameters, and thus the brake parameter to be effected may, for example, be distributed equally between braking devices 12, 14, 16 situated on the same axle.
[0056] Due to this described prioritization of brake the braking devices 12, 14, 16, for example, for small desired brake parameters, only one of the braking devices 12, 14, 16 will be utilized. When, for example, the desired brake parameters exceeds the capabilities of said one braking devices 12, 14, 16, another of the braking devices 12, 14, 16 will also become utilized. When, for example, the desired brake parameter rises further, further braking devices 12, 14, 16 will be utilized as necessary.
[0057] Embodiments may for example prefer non-frictional, regenerational brakes determining a higher priority for them, to extend the range of the vehicle and extend any maintenance intervals. Frictional first brakes 12 may, for example, only be utilized when the brake capability of all the other braking devices 14, 16 is not sufficient to effect the desired brake parameter.
[0058] The term highest priority may have different representations according to how priority is represented. Where priority is represented for example as a number, the highest priority may, for example, be represented by the highest number or may, for example, be represented by the lowest number.
[0059] The term operating capability may, for example, refer to a maximum of a braking parameter attainable by the brake device, for example a maximum torque and/or a maximum force and/or a maximum acceleration.
[0060] The actuation parameter, the desired brake parameter and/or the maximum brake function may be represented in any suitable manner. In different embodiments, they may be represented, for example, as a torque value, a percentage of a reference value, an integer or floating point number.
[0061] The methods described above may be performed by a properly programmed general purpose computer alone or in connection with a special purpose computer. Such processing may be performed by a single platform or by a distributed processing platform. In addition, such processing and functionality can be implemented in the form of special purpose hardware or in the form of software or firmware being run by a general-purpose or network processor. Data handled in such processing or created as a result of such processing can be stored in any memory as is conventional in the art. By way of example, such data may be stored in a temporary memory, such as in the RAM of a given computer system or subsystem. In addition, or in the alternative, such data may be stored in longer-term storage devices, for example, magnetic disks, rewritable optical disks, solid state drives, and so on. For purposes of the disclosure herein, a computer-readable media may comprise any form of data storage mechanism, including such existing memory technologies as well as hardware or circuit representations of such structures and of such data.
[0062] Any above reference to data structures, e.g. integer number, floating-point number, list, dictionary, array etc. refers to the concept of said data structure and shall be understood to not be limited to any particular implementation or physical representation of said structure within a computing and/or storage device.
LIST OF REFERENCES
[0063] 10 braking system [0064] 12 (frictional/first) braking device (brake) [0065] 14 (dissipational/second) braking device (brake) [0066] 16 (regenerational/third) braking device (brake) [0067] 18 control device